What is the most famous Arthur Conan Doyle quote?

5 Answers2025-12-21 14:09:22
One of the most recognizable quotes from Arthur Conan Doyle is, 'When you have eliminated the impossible, whatever remains, however improbable, must be the truth.' This line, coming from ‘The Sign of the Four,’ perfectly encapsulates Sherlock Holmes's methodical approach to deduction. I absolutely love how this quote has permeated popular culture, resonating with fans of not just the stories but even those outside the realm of mystery. For someone who has spent countless hours delving into detective novels, it really drives home the idea that logic and reason can pierce through the fog of doubt. It's almost a comforting reminder that even in life’s chaotic moments, we can still find clarity, provided we look at the facts straight. Did Sir Arthur Conan Doyle write quotes about detective work?

4 Answers2025-07-31 16:42:30
As a lifelong fan of detective fiction, I've spent countless hours diving into the works of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, and yes, he absolutely wrote about detective work, often through the brilliant mind of Sherlock Holmes. One of my favorite quotes from 'The Adventures of Sherlock Holmes' is, 'It is a capital mistake to theorize before one has data. Insensibly one begins to twist facts to suit theories, instead of theories to suit facts.' This line perfectly captures Holmes' methodical approach, emphasizing the importance of evidence over assumptions. Another gem comes from 'A Scandal in Bohemia,' where Holmes says, 'You see, but you do not observe.' This distinction between seeing and observing is a cornerstone of detective work, reminding us that details matter. Doyle didn’t just write mysteries; he embedded timeless wisdom about deduction, observation, and logic into Holmes' dialogue. These quotes aren’t just lines from a book—they’re lessons in critical thinking that resonate far beyond the pages.

Are there free ebooks with Sir Arthur Conan Doyle's quotes?

4 Answers2025-07-31 17:14:06
As a literature enthusiast who spends hours scouring the internet for hidden gems, I can confidently say there are several sources where you can find free ebooks featuring Sir Arthur Conan Doyle's quotes. Project Gutenberg is a fantastic starting point; it offers a vast collection of his works, including 'The Adventures of Sherlock Holmes' and 'The Hound of the Baskervilles,' both brimming with his iconic wit and wisdom. ManyBooks and Open Library also host his classics, often with highlighted quotes sections. For those who enjoy anthologies, 'The Man Who Was Sherlock Holmes' and 'The Complete Sherlock Holmes' are available on platforms like Google Books and Internet Archive. These compilations often include footnotes or annotations that highlight Doyle's most memorable lines. If you're into audiobooks, Librivox has free recordings where narrators emphasize his quotes dramatically. Doyle's philosophical musings in 'The Stark Munro Letters' are another treasure trove, available in PDF formats on academic sites.
